China's Foreign Minister Congratulates Sudan's New Foreign Affairs Minister
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i sent a congratulatory message to Mohieddin Salem, Sudan's new Minister of Foreign Affairs and International Cooperation, on Wednesday, expressing China's deep traditional friendship with Sudan and commitment to strengthening bilateral ties. The message highlighted the importance of the China-Sudan strategic partnership, which marks its 10th anniversary this year. Wang Yi expressed his willingness to work with Mohieddin Salem to promote new progress in the partnership and strengthen contacts and coordination between the two foreign ministries. The message also recalled the meeting between Chinese President Xi Jinping and Sudan's Chairman of the Transitional Sovereign Council, Abdel Fattah al-Burhan, at the Forum on China-Africa Cooperation summit in Beijing last year.
